WELCOMING YOU TO THE TEAM Our story starts in 1911, manufacturing cables to support the distribution of power generated from Niagara Falls, Nexans has proudly contributed to Canada's growth. We have been involved in many of Canada's most ambitious projects; from dams, bridges, energy transmission and distribution to railroads and transportation. We are a vertically integrated manufacturer and our products are made at facilities located in Quebec, Ontario, and Saskatchewan.
